1. Florida Institute of Technology

The College of Psychology and Liberal Arts of Florida Institute of Technology is so unique. Both graduate and undergraduate psychology degrees are offered in abundance at the Florida Institute of Technology.

Florida Tech offers excellent on-campus undergraduate psychology programs, but its online undergraduate psychology programs are where it really excels.

The Associate of Arts and Bachelor of Arts in Applied Psychology are its two most popular online psychology degrees.

In addition, Florida Institute of Technology stands out for the chances it provides for both academic and professional development. For instance, the Psychology Honors Program enables talented juniors to take on additional difficulties by participating in seminars and preparing an undergraduate thesis.

Undergraduate Programs:

  • A.A. in Applied Psychology
  • B.A. in Applied Psychology

Graduate Programs:

  • None (all are on-campus)

Program Options:

  • Part-Time
  • Full-Time
  • Fully-Online

Specializations Offered:

  • Child Advocacy
  • Clinical Psychology
  • Forensic Psychology
  • Organizational Psychology

2. Saint Leo University

Saint Leo University’s psychology degree programs give students the option to obtain a psychology degree through completely online and hybrid learning formats in addition to the programs offered at its main campus in St. Leo and its several Education Centers across the United States.

The 120 credit hour total for the two Bachelor of Arts in Psychology degrees includes 39 credits that are specifically related to the study of either counseling/clinical psychology or general psychology.

Both bachelor’s degree programs allow for both on-campus and online coursework to be completed. The Master of Science in Psychology, however, is entirely online.

The curriculum requirements are progressed through as a class under the program’s cohort format. Asynchronous completion of its 36 necessary credits gives students the option for self-paced learning.

Undergraduate Programs:

  • B.A. in Psychology

Graduate Programs:

  • M.S. in Psychology

Program Options:

  • Part-Time
  • Full-Time
  • Fully-Online
  • Partially-Online

Specializations Offered:

  • Clinical/Counseling Psychology
  • General Psychology

3. Nova Southeastern University

One of Florida’s top universities for online psychology degrees is Nova Southeastern University. The majority of the psychology degrees that NSU offers through its College of Psychology follow traditional learning styles, which entail on-campus, full-time classes.

The majority of NSU’s master’s programs, nevertheless, are also accessible to evening and weekend students, in addition to being offered online and in a hybrid format.

Online master’s students have plenty of opportunities to get real-world experience through as many as fifteen on-site clinical learning experiences in addition to doing several of the needed courses online.

Additionally, there are four specialty options available to master’s students, including counseling. Graduates of this academic program are qualified to apply for state licensing after successfully completing it.

Undergraduate Programs:

  • B.S. in Psychology
  • B.S. in Neuroscience

Graduate Programs:

  • M.S. in Psychology
  • Psy.S. in School Psychology
  • Psy.D. in School Psychology
  • Ph.D. in Clinical Psychology
  • Psy.D. in Clinical Psychology

Specializations Offered:

  • Applied Behavior Analysis
  • Counseling
  • Experimental Psychology
  • Psychology for Health sciences
  • Forensic Studies
  • General Psychology
  • Forensic Psychology
  • Neuroscience
  • General Psychology

Program Options:

  • Part-Time
  • Full-Time
  • Partially-Online
